Cracking the Code: Understanding Crypto Loyalty Tiers & How They Work
Crypto loyalty programs aren't just about accumulating points; they're a sophisticated system designed to incentivize active participation and investment within a decentralized ecosystem. Unlike traditional loyalty schemes that often offer generic discounts, crypto tiers typically unlock a range of exclusive benefits directly tied to your holdings and engagement. This can include reduced trading fees, higher staking rewards, preferential access to new token launches (IDOs/IEOs), and even governance voting rights. The core principle is simple: the more you commit to the platform, usually by holding their native token or staking assets, the greater your rewards and influence become. Understanding these tiers is crucial for maximizing your returns and actively shaping the future of the protocols you believe in.
The mechanics of these loyalty tiers often involve a tiered structure, where users progress through different levels based on specific criteria. Common metrics include:
- Amount of native token held: The most straightforward method, rewarding larger investors.
- Staked assets: Encouraging long-term commitment and network security.
- Trading volume: Benefitting active traders on decentralized exchanges.
- Liquidity provision: Rewarding those who contribute to the protocol's liquidity pools.
Each tier typically comes with a distinct set of perks, clearly outlined by the project. For example, a 'Bronze' tier might offer a 5% reduction in fees, while a 'Platinum' tier could grant 20% fee reduction, early access to new features, and a direct line to customer support. It's essential to meticulously review each project's loyalty program documentation to fully grasp the requirements and benefits associated with each level.

Beyond the Bonus: Comparing Traditional vs. Crypto Loyalty Benefits
Traditional loyalty programs, often centered around points, discounts, and tiered memberships, have long been the bedrock of customer retention. While effective, their benefits are typically centralized and restricted within the issuing brand's ecosystem. Think of airline miles that only apply to one carrier or coffee shop loyalty cards that are single-use. The value accumulation is often slow, and the redemption process can sometimes be opaque or limited to specific products and services. Furthermore, these programs are vulnerable to changes in company policy, devaluations, and even outright cancellation, leaving customers with little recourse. Their primary strength lies in their familiarity and ease of use for the general public, requiring minimal technical understanding.
Crypto loyalty benefits, in stark contrast, introduce a paradigm shift by leveraging the power of blockchain technology. Instead of proprietary points, customers can earn fungible or non-fungible tokens (NFTs) directly tied to their engagement. This offers a level of transparency and immutability previously unattainable. Imagine earning tokens that can be traded on exchanges, used across various participating merchants, or even staked for passive income. The ownership of these digital assets grants users more control and the potential for real-world value outside the original brand's purview. This innovative approach moves beyond mere discounts, fostering a sense of true ownership and a more dynamic, liquid reward system.
The true differentiator lies in the interoperability and potential for appreciation that crypto loyalty offers. Unlike traditional points, which are essentially liabilities on a company's balance sheet, well-designed crypto rewards can appreciate in value, transforming a customer's loyalty into a genuine asset.
